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To relax (entertain) a dog as the alternative to an owner when the owner is absent, so as to remove uneasy feeling of the dog and to prevent noise to ambient homes. <P>SOLUTION: By sensing cry of the dog, prerecorded voice data such as the owners voice are reproduced corresponding to the cry.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2008,JPO&INPIT

In recent years, pets such as dogs kept indoors, such as urban condominiums, have increased along with the increase in living alone. However, there are situations in which only pets are forced to leave their homes during the day because of their owners' work.
In such a case, an increase in the anxiety of the pet itself, and a crying sound accompanying it, cause noise problems to neighboring houses.
In the present invention, when the owner is away, the pet (mainly a dog) is accompanied by the pet, and the pet's mood is stabilized and the noise is reduced by stopping the crying.

犬の無駄吠えをセンシングして、首輪を通して微弱電流を流したり、高音、バイブレータなどにより犬をびっくりさせ、吠えることをやめさせるシステムがある。ほかには、防音壁や防音マットを取り付け、鳴声が外部へ洩れないようにしたり、インターネットカメラなどで飼い主が遠隔監視して、遠隔で声をかける技術がある。There is a system that senses the dog's waste barking and allows a weak current to flow through the collar, and the dog is surprised by treble and a vibrator to stop barking. In addition, there are technologies to attach soundproof walls and soundproof mats to prevent the sound from leaking to the outside, or to remotely monitor the owner by using an internet camera, etc.

従来の方法では、無理に吠えることを止めさせる方法であり、動物愛護の観点から良い方法ではなかった。また、防音壁や防音マットを取り付けた場合、騒音低減には効果があるが、費用もそれなりにかかるし、ペットの気分好転には効果がない。インターネットカメラなどで飼い主が遠隔監視して、遠隔で声をかける技術もあるが、飼い主は頻繁に監視せねばならないし、監視している時間だけしか効果がない。また、機器の設置自体も一般的には困難である。In the conventional method, it is a method to stop barking forcibly, and it is not a good method from the viewpoint of animal welfare. In addition, when a soundproof wall or a soundproof mat is attached, it is effective in reducing noise, but costs are appropriate, and it is not effective in improving the mood of pets. There is also a technology that allows the owner to remotely monitor and speak remotely with an internet camera, etc., but the owner has to monitor frequently and is effective only during the monitoring time. In addition, installation of the device itself is generally difficult.

FIG. 1 is a flowchart of the present invention.
(I) Dogs who feel anxiety when their owners are away will cry.
(B) This sound is sensed with a microphone, and it is determined whether or not the volume is above a certain level.
(C) When the volume is above a certain level, voice data such as the owner's voice recorded in advance is output through a speaker.
(D) The dog becomes quiet when he hears the owner's voice.
By storing a plurality of audio data and appropriately changing the audio data to be reproduced or changing the reproduction volume, it is possible to prevent the dog from getting used to it.
By analyzing not only the sound volume but also the sound volume, the sound data to be reproduced can be changed according to the frequency and the inflection of the sound.
